Ordering spare parts   

 

For trouble-free replacement in the event of faults, 
we recommend keeping spare parts available on 
site.   

 

 

The following information is mandatory when ordering 

spare parts (→ Name plate):   

– 

Pump model   

– 

Year of manufacture   

– 

Part number / Description of part required   

– 

Serial number   

– 

Quantity   

 

8. 

Storing pumps and hoses 

 

Verderflex pumps are designed for continuous use, 
however, there may be instances when pumps are 
withdrawn from use and stored for extended periods. 
We recommend certain pre-storage actions and 
precautions be taken whilst pumps and their 
components are not in use.   

Similarly, hoses and lubricants may be held in stock 
to service working pumps and their recommended 
storage conditions are advised.   

8.1.1 

Pre-Storage Actions   

– 

The hose should be removed from the pump and 
lubricant drained out from the pump casing.   

– 

The pump casing should be washed out allowed to dry 
and any external build up of product removed.   

8.1.2 

Cleaning Protocol for hoses   

VERDERFLEX hoses should be cleaned with the 
following protocol –   

NR and NBR Hoses:   

First flush 0.5% Nitric Acid (HNO3) solution at up 
to 60°C   

Second flush 4% Caustic soda (NaOH) solution 
and eventually steamed open ends for 15 
minutes at up to 110°C   

EPDM Hoses:   

First flush 2.0% Nitric Acid (HNO3) solution at up 
to 80°C   

Second flush 10% Caustic soda (NaOH) solution 
and eventually steamed open ends for 30 
minutes at up to 130°C   

Final flush: flush with clean water to remove all 
traces of cleaning solutions   

Under no circumstances should VERDERFLEX 
NBRF food grade hoses be cleaned with Sodium 
hypochlorite (NaOCl) based cleaning solutions, 
neither should the above concentrations, 
exposure, durations or temperatures be 
exceeded.   

 

8.1.3 

Storage Conditions   

– 

Pumps should be stored in a dry environment, out of 
direct sunlight. Depending on these conditions, it may 
be advisable to place a moisture-absorbing product, 
such as Silica gel, inside the pump’s casing or to coat 
the pump’s inner surfaces with moisture-repelling oil, 
such as WD40, whilst the pump is stored.   

– 

Gearboxes may require intermittent attention as 
indicated by the gearbox manufacturer’s 
recommendations.   

– 

Hoses should be stored as supplied in their wrapper 
and should be stored away from direct sunlight and at 
room temperature with end caps fitted.   

– 

Lubricants should be stored under normal warehouse 
conditions with their caps securely fastened.
